Honda and Google to collaborate on in-vehicle connected services

Green Car Congress

Honda and Google have agreed to integrate Google’s in-vehicle connected service into an all-new model that will come to market in the second half of 2022 in North America. As a result of this collaboration, Honda began adopting Android Auto starting with the Accord in 2016.

BMW Connected North America makes its world debut at Microsoft Build 2016; powered by Azure

Green Car Congress

BMW Connected, a new personal mobility companion, made its world debut at Microsoft Build 2016, Microsoft’s developer conference, last week. The first version—called BMW Connected North America—is now available at the Apple App Store to BMW ConnectedDrive customers in the US for iOS devices.

Arity partners with Ford to enable more efficient usage-based insurance (UBI) offerings

Green Car Congress

Arity , a mobility data and analytics company, is teaming up with Ford Motor Company to enable any participating insurer to deliver simple and secure usage-based insurance (UBI) programs to eligible connected Ford and Lincoln vehicle owners. GM and IBM bring OnStar and Watson together for new cognitive mobility platform: OnStar Go

Green Car Congress

Starting in early 2017, OnStar is expected to give millions of GM drivers the ability to connect and interact with their favorite brands. The platform will deliver personalized content through the dashboard and other digital channels supported by the OnStar Go ecosystem to make the most of time spent in the car.

“Better off sharing”: Opel launches CarUnity brand-agnostic carsharing concept

Green Car Congress

The CarUnity app can be downloaded for free from the Apple App Store and Google Play. CarUnity users can, for example, offer their car only to their Facebook friends or to people in their personal CarUnity network. From 2016, flinc will provide the technical platform so that ridesharing can also be offered via the car-sharing app.
